Civil rights are rights that citizens have to ensure political and social freedom and equality. An individual citizen can sue a government employee for violating their civil rights under 42 U.S.C. § 1983, also known as the Civil Rights Act of 1871, a federal law.

Federal courts are authorized to hear only civil cases that involve one or more of the following: Questions regarding the Constitution. Questions of federal law (as opposed to state law) A dispute among residents of different states with an amount in controversy of more than $75,000.

Section 1983 allows claims alleging the ?deprivation of any rights, privileges, or immunities secured by the Constitution and [federal laws].? 42 U.S.C. § 1983. This claim must be filed in federal court, and you will need to show that the violation occurred while the officer was acting under color of law. You will also need to show that the violation resulted in some kind of harm, such as physical injury, emotional distress, or financial damages.

The types of civil cases that can be brought in the Federal courts are speci- fied in Article III of the United States Consti tution. These include: Cases arising under the United Sta tes Constitution, Federal statutes, and treaties.

UNDER THE CIVIL RIGHTS STATUTE, 42 U.S.C. § 1983. I. Scope of Section 1983. An action under Section 1983 is available to challenge violations of the federal constitution or federal statutes which affect the conditions of your confinement or your treatment by government employees while in custody.

The most common complaint involves allegations of color of law violations. Another common complaint involves racial violence, such as physical assaults, homicides, verbal or written threats, or desecration of property.

As a result, civil rights cases can include some or all of the following: Freedom from excessive force by police or other law enforcement. Freedom from unreasonable searches or seizures by police or other law enforcement. Freedom from false arrest by police or other law enforcement.
